Franeker ’t War is located in the province of Friesland, in the municipality of Waadhoeke, in the district Franeker The neighbourhood has a total area of 19 hectares, of which 19 hectares are land and 0 hectares are water. The neighbourhood is coded as BU19492815. The postcode area is 8802BA-8802BR.
Franeker ’t War has 540 residents. Of these, 50,0% are men and 50,0% are women. Most residents are 45 to 65 years (34,3%). The other age groups are 29,6% for '65 years or older', 13,0% for '0 to 15 years', 13,0% for '15 to 25 years' and 12,0% for '25 to 45 years'. Of the residents, 33,3% is unmarried, 60,2% is married, 3,7% is divorced and 2,8% is widowed. 500 residents originate from the Netherlands, 15 come from Europe and 25 come from countries outside Europe.
There are 220 households in Franeker ’t War. 13,6% of these are single-person households, 50,0% households without children and 36,4% households with children. The average household size is 2,5 persons.
In Franeker ’t War there are 500 income recipients. The average income per income recipient is €36.500, which is €700 (2%) higher than the national average of €35.800. Per resident, the average income is €30.400, which is €1.200 (4%) higher than the national average of €29.200. Most residents of Franeker ’t War are educated to an intermediate level. 44,4% have an intermediate education (HAVO, VWO or MBO 2-4), 33,3% have a university or higher professional education (HBO/WO) and 22,2% have a lower education (VMBO or MBO 1).
Of the 540 residents, around 63% are in paid employment, which amounts to 340 people. This is 2% lower than the national average of 65%. The majority of workers are in salaried employment (89%), while 11% are self-employed. In Franeker ’t War, 26% of residents receive a benefit. The largest group is those receiving a state pension (AOW). 130 people receive this benefit.
In Franeker ’t War there are 221 homes with an average assessed value (WOZ) of €380.000. Of these, around 99% are occupied and 1% unoccupied. All homes in Franeker ’t War are owner-occupied. This amounts to 0% rental homes and 100% owner-occupied homes. Of the homes, 100% privately owned. The most common construction periods in Franeker ’t War are 1990-2000 (82%) and 2000-2010 (17%).

In Franeker ’t War there are 221 addresses with a registered energy label. The most common labels are B (61%), A (34%) and C (4%). On average, an address in Franeker ’t War uses 2.880 kWh of electricity per year. This is 2% above the national average of 2.810 kWh. With an annual consumption of 1.120 m³ per address, natural gas consumption is 13% below the national average of 1.280 m³.
